A completely renewed portfolio of designers for MDF Italia

MDF Italia has always been a company devoted to experimentation, and this year it is pursuing its goal through a completely renewed portfolio of designers, with whom it will chart a creative course focused on innovation. The new season is also defined by environmental awareness, which informs choices and processes, and is now the starting point of every design adventure.

While the company has already distinguished itself over time for its ability to offer a warm, tactile interpretation of minimalism, it is increasingly embracing an aesthetic that tones down the brand's long-standing formal rigour. Similarly, at the MDF Italia stand at the Salone del Mobile, designed again this year by architect Pitsou Kedem, geometry, which is always the key principle, softens and dissolves, mellowing into soft, bright tones: an invitation to lower the volume in our rooms.

"MDF Italia's new DNA was created in the groove between meditative silence and dynamic living," explains Kedem. "This is expressed in tables with rounded corners that can be joined together, as well as in the new sofa, which can generate movement from small, static elements."

Array is a sofa system designed by Snøhetta to offer maximum flexibility and comfort. It represents a new approach to sofa design and construction, with the goal of reducing environmental impact, achieving customised living solutions, and simplifying logistics. To this end, it introduces small modules, which permit a variety of layouts, are easy to transport, and can be easily disassembled and reassembled for replacement or recycling.
The concept of comfort extends to the entire supply chain, moving beyond its ergonomic component.

The robust injection-moulded base made of recycled plastic, which leaves a hollow core inside, minimises the use of material. The bio-foam in the seat and back is moulded for optimal comfort. The fabric cover is also available in recycled polyester. The Array collection is developed from both a micro and macro perspective and is suitable for residential and contract contexts.
